Overview
An Energy Star compliant, fully encapsulated driverless 120V architectural LED linear lightbar that enables selection between three color temperatures. Covalinear is driverless and tunable, enabling 2700K, 3000K and 3500K light temperatures. The 9-inch CL9-TUN-WH delivers 280 lumens with a frosted lens that assures an even glow over the length of the fixture. Rigid and unobtrusive at only 1-1/4" tall, this multi-faceted tunable LED lighter utilizes a dense array of strategically placed LEDs for superior illumination.
Features
- Tunable white 3CCT selectable switch (2700K, 3000K, 3500K)
- Up to 280 lumens output
- Dry location rated
- Diode free illumination for clean, even light distribution
- Dimmable (Triac compatible)
- 120° viewing angle for wide light spread
- Modular - units can be joined together for longer runs
- Maximum run on a given lead is 40'
- Operating temperature: -4°F to 122°F
- Frosted lens ensures uniform glow
Specifications
Electrical: 120V, 3.5W
Optics: 2700K, 3000K, 3500K selectable, 90+ CRI
Label: ETL, Title 24 - JA8
Warranty: 5 years
Finish: White
Dimensions: 9" / 229mm length
What's Included: Each fixture comes with (2) standard mounting clips and (2) screws for surface mounting, (2) 45° mounting clips and (2) screws, and (1) CL1-BB-WH bar to bar connector.
Applications
Ideal for under cabinet lighting, cove lighting, display lighting, architectural accent lighting, task lighting in kitchens and workspaces, retail displays, hospitality environments, and residential or commercial applications requiring clean, tunable white light. Perfect for projects demanding precise color temperature control and seamless integration.

What are the main types of under cabinet lights?
The main types of under cabinet lights are strip lights, puck lights, and light bars. Strip lights are flexible and provide a continuous, even glow. Puck lights are small and circular, offering focused, spotlight-like illumination. Light bars are rigid fixtures that provide uniform light in a compact form.

What light source is best for under cabinet lighting?
LEDs (Light Emitting Diodes) are widely considered the best under cabinet lighting source. While older alternatives like fluorescent and halogen were once common, LEDs are far more energy-efficient, last for tens of thousands of hours, and produce very little heat, making them a safer and more cost-effective choice for your under cabinet LED lighting.

What's the difference between hardwired, plug-in, and battery-powered under cabinet lighting?
Hardwired under cabinet lighting is a permanent solution installed directly into your home's electrical wiring, providing a seamless look with no visible cords. Plug-in under cabinet lighting is a convenient, non-permanent option that plugs into a standard outlet. Battery-powered under cabinet lighting offers ultimate portability and ease of installation, perfect for areas without nearby outlets.

What color temperature should I choose for my kitchen?
The ideal color temperature for your under cabinet light depends on your desired ambiance. A warmer white (2700K-3000K) creates a cozy, inviting feel, while a neutral or natural white (3500K-4000K) is a versatile choice for both task lighting and everyday use. A cooler white (5000K+) offers a crisp, modern look ideal for detailed tasks.

What is the benefit of low voltage under cabinet lighting?
Low voltage under cabinet lighting is a very safe option, as it operates at 12V or 24V using a power supply, reducing the risk of electrical shock. The thinner wiring is also easier to conceal, making it a popular choice for sleek, discreet installations in a variety of applications.
